Mike Sleap is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Physiology and Social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Mike Sleap has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 445 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 9 papers in Physiology and 3 papers in Social Psychology. Recurrent topics in Mike Sleap’s work include Physical Activity and Health (9 papers),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(9 papers) and Children's Physical and Motor Development (2 papers). Mike Sleap is often cited by papers focused on Physical Activity and Health (9 papers),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(9 papers) and Children's Physical and Motor Development (2 papers). Mike Sleap coll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Australia. Mike Sleap's co-authors include Peter Warburton, Keith Tolfrey, Lee Ingle, Adam B. Evans, Heidi C. Waters, H. Wormald, Martha Paisi, Barbara A. Brown‐Elliott, Martin White and Louise Hayes and has published in prestigious journals such as Medicine & Science in Sports & Exercise, BMC Public Health and Journal of Sports Sciences.
